Any student who is interested in computer science needs to take a look at Emory University. Emory is a fairly large private not-for-profit university located in the city of Atlanta. A Best Colleges rank of #31 out of 2,152 schools nationwide means Emory is a great university overall.
There were about 101 computer science students who graduated with this degree at Emory in the most recent year we have data available.

University of Georgia is a great option for students interested in a degree in computer science. UGA is a fairly large public university located in the midsize city of Athens. A Best Colleges rank of #69 out of 2,152 schools nationwide means UGA is a great university overall.
There were approximately 343 computer science students who graduated with this degree at UGA in the most recent year we have data available.

Georgia Institute of Technology - Main Campus is a good choice for students pursuing a degree in computer science. Georgia Tech is a fairly large public school located in the city of Atlanta. A Best Colleges rank of #19 out of 2,152 schools nationwide means Georgia Tech is a great school overall.
There were about 141 computer science students who graduated with this degree at Georgia Tech in the most recent data year.

Any student pursuing a degree in computer science needs to look into Georgia State University. Georgia State is a fairly large public university located in the city of Atlanta. This university ranks 17th out of 68 colleges for overall quality in the state of Georgia.
There were roughly 426 computer science students who graduated with this degree at Georgia State in the most recent data year.
